Use of suitable tenses - Simple Past and Past Perfect
NOTE : We use Simple Past if we give past events in the order in which they
occurred. However, when we look back from a certain time in the past to tell
what had happened before, we use Past Perfect.

*Note: "After" is only used as a signal word for Past Perfect if it is followed by a
subject + verb, meaning that one action had been completed before another
action began (the new action is in Simple Past).
Example:
After the family had had breakfast, they went to the zoo.
However, if "after" is followed by object + subject + verb, the verb belongs to
the new action and is therefore in Simple Past.
Example:
After her visit to the zoo, Jane was exhausted.

First of all, a good friend should be someone who understands you well. For
instance, when you are moody or sad. A good friend would be able to identify
these emotions and give appropriate responses to those situations. A true friend
will cheer you up when you are down. Thus, you can always share your feelings
with someone that you trust. A trustworthy friend is as precious as a diamond.
Hence, your good friend must be good at keeping secrets.
Besides that, you need to find someone who is helpful as your friend. She
may help you in your studies especially in your weak subjects. In other words,
good friends are willing to help each other to excel in studies and to be a better
person. Moreover, a good friend also shares your victorious moments. For
example, when you score the highest in your class, she should be happy for you
and celebrate your successful achievement. Nevertheless, she also shares your
38
sorrows . She should lend a shoulder for you to cry on like the saying A friend
in need is a friend indeed. Good friends should help each other when one is
facing with difficulties.
Next, a good friend remembers the birth date of her friends. She must wish
you Happy Birthday on your birthday and vice versa. This is a sign of
closeness. However, its not necessary for her to buy you a gift for your birthday.
Its enough that she remembers your birthday. If she holds a birthday party for
you that will be a bonus! Furthermore, always find a friend that is dependable .
If you can count on your friend in good health or in sickness consider that youre
lucky. The most important quality in a good friend is to find someone who has
positive qualities like being sincere and responsible. Those are essential
qualities that can build a strong and long-lasting friendship.
In addition, your friendship could be better if your good friend shares the
same interests as you. This will enable the two of you to communicate more
effectively. Consequently, you can share your views and learn more by sharing
your ideas.
